unity 回転する方向
Unityには特定のターゲットに回転させる便利メソッドがいくつか用意されています 本記事では以下動画のように特定の対象物にオブジェクトを回転させる方法を紹介します TransformLookA. はじめに 上のようにプレイヤーの移動方向に向きを変更したいときってありませんか モデルは適当に作ったので若干気持ち悪くて申し訳ないです今回はそのやり方を書いていきたいと思います 仕組み 移動方向に向きを変更するにはQuaternionLookRotationVector3 forwardがキーとなります.
Mayaリギング 意外と重要 ジョイント方向付けとそのルール 3dcgあるある研究所 リギング ジョイント 意外
Unityではオブジェクトの向きは傾き姿勢から計算することができます しかしながらオブジェクトの 前 や 右 上 といった決まった向きはTransformプロパティから 向きベクトル として簡単に取得できます.

. Unity で Rigidbody をアタッチしたゲームオブジェクトをトルクによって回転させるスクリプトのサンプルです入力した方向キーの向きに回転する力が加わります 空の3Dプロジェクトを開いて Sphere オブ 続きを読む. 6 Vector3型方向から回転量を得る上下の回転は抑止する QuaternionLookRotationは元となる位置とtargetの位置からtargetの方向を回転量Quaternion型として得ます下のサンプルは第2パラメータが省略されているため上下方向の回転量が抑止されています. これを有効化すると軸の値はボタンを反対方向に押したときに0 にリセットされます Invert.
Unityで進行方向に対し緩やかに回転させる方法をご紹介します Unityの回転方法は少しばかり複雑ですが標準関数を使えば意外とすんなりできたりします 緩やかに進行方向へ回転させる際の注意点も添えてありますので参考にし. 6 Vector3型方向から回転量を得る上下の回転は抑止する サンプルは 自分の位置 と 相手の位置 から方向を算出しそれをもとに回転量Quaternion型を得ている QuaternionLookRotation の第2パラメータを省略すると上下方向の回転が抑止される. NozzleはZ軸方向が先端となるようにする 流れとしてはBaseに回転制限をするスクリプトをアタッチする 2回転角度を制限するスクリプトを作成.
回転と言われるとx軸y軸z軸の周りの三軸回転を想像することが多いと思いますがQuaternionは任意軸回転が基本です 要するに xyz軸に限定されず 自分の好きな方向に軸を1つ取る ことができその軸周りで回転を与えることができます. Unityでの軸を思い浮かべて矢印の先から矢印が出ている根元0 0 0の座標の方向上の図の茶色い矢印方向を見ていると仮定します X軸の回転であればX軸の矢印の先から0 0 0の方向を見ている状態での時計回りが正の回転になります. UnityでRotationQuaternionをうまく使いたい 2015531 UnityのベクトルとQuaternionによる回転について 201482 Unityで回転したかったお話 2015120 クラスを問わず回転操作に関係する関数 2014103 Unity基本メソッド覚書 20130321 座標変換クォータニオン.
これを有効化するとNegative Buttons は正の値に反転しPositive Buttons は負の値に反転します Type. Unity Unity3dキャラクターの移動処理 入力した方向へ移動するタイプAdd Star. キーボードで入力している時にあれさっきまでと入力方法がちがうと 突然キーボードがおかしくなってうまく入力できない ことや入力できなくなったりしたことありますよね 突然変わって戻し方が分からなかったりキーボードの特定の箇所が入力できなくなったりして.
Comments
Post a Comment